Should one blow dry the vagina after sex?

Do you constantly have problems with infections in the genital area? Then you may be scrutinizing this tip.

US gynecologist Alyssa Dweck writes in her book, The Complete A to Z for your V, that women who often have vaginal yeast should simply blow-dry their vagina after having sex. In detail, the procedure should proceed as follows: First, clean the vagina with warm water. Then blow dry at the coldest level. It is important, however, that you do not blown too long - because the vagina should not dry out. Alternatively, you could just grab the towel.

Reasons for infections are manifold!

Whether or not you believe in the foehn effect: in the end, the reasons for frequent vaginal infections can be manifold. That's why it's so important to have one Doctors to ask for advice. He can decide on a case-by-case basis where the problem is coming from and what the right form of treatment is.
